URL Replacement in PHP

I'm trying to change a value in a string that's holding my current URL. I'm trying to get something like

http://myurl.com/test/begin.php?req=&srclang=english&destlang=english&service=MyMemory

to look like

http://myurl.com/test/end.php?req=&srclang=english&destlang=english&service=MyMemory

replacing begin.php for end.php.

I need the end.php to be stored in a variable so it can change, but begin.php can be a static string.

I tried this, but it didn't work:

$endURL   = 'end.php';
$beginURL = 'begin.php';
$newURL   = str_ireplace($beginURL,$endURL,$url);

EDIT: Also, if I wanted to replace

http://myurl.com/begin.php?req=&srclang=english&destlang=english&service=MyMemory

with

http://newsite.com/end.php?req=&srclang=english&destlang=english&service=MyMemory

then how would I go about doing that?

Assuming that you want to replace the script filename of the url, you can use something like this :

<?php 
  $endURL   = 'end.php';
  $url ="http://myurl.com/test/begin.php?req=&srclang=english&destlang=english&service=MyMemory";
  $pattern = '/(.+)\/([^?\/]+)\?(.+)/';
  $replacement = '${1}/'.$endURL.'?${3}';
  $newURL = preg_replace($pattern , $replacement, $url);

   echo "url : $url <br>";
   echo "newURL : $newURL <br>";
?>

I recently made a PHP-file for this, it ended up looking like this:

$vars = $_SERVER["QUERY_STRING"];
$filename = $_SERVER["PHP_SELF"];
$filename = substr($filename, 4);
// for me substr removed 'abc/' in the beginning of the string, you can of course adjust this variable, this is the "end.php"-variable for you.

if (strlen($vars) > 0) $vars = '?' . $vars;
$resultURL = "http://somewhere.com" . $filename . $vars;
